emacs-elpa-diffs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[elpa] externals/eldoc-eval deca5e39f3 13/28: Fix eldoc compat with emac


From: Stefan Monnier
Subject: [elpa] externals/eldoc-eval deca5e39f3 13/28: Fix eldoc compat with emacs-25.
Date: Thu, 6 Jan 2022 08:34:55 -0500 (EST)

branch: externals/eldoc-eval
commit deca5e39f31282a06531002d289258cd099433c0
Author: Thierry Volpiatto <thierry.volpiatto@gmail.com>
Commit: Thierry Volpiatto <thierry.volpiatto@gmail.com>

    Fix eldoc compat with emacs-25.
    
    * eldoc-eval.el (eldoc-run-in-minibuffer): Fix looking-back for emacs-25.
---
 eldoc-eval.el | 6 +++---
 1 file changed, 3 insertions(+), 3 deletions(-)

diff --git a/eldoc-eval.el b/eldoc-eval.el
index eb7d5799a9..ec23f4b6d8 100644
--- a/eldoc-eval.el
+++ b/eldoc-eval.el
@@ -54,8 +54,8 @@
 (when (require 'elisp-mode nil t) ; emacs-25
   (defalias 'eldoc-current-symbol 'elisp--current-symbol)
   (defalias 'eldoc-fnsym-in-current-sexp 'elisp--fnsym-in-current-sexp)
-  (defalias 'eldoc-get-fnsym-args-string 'elisp--get-fnsym-args-string)
-  (defalias 'eldoc-get-var-docstring 'elisp--get-var-docstring))
+  (defalias 'eldoc-get-fnsym-args-string 'elisp-get-fnsym-args-string)
+  (defalias 'eldoc-get-var-docstring 'elisp-get-var-docstring))
 
 ;;; Minibuffer support.
 ;;  Enable displaying eldoc info in something else
@@ -221,7 +221,7 @@ See `with-eldoc-in-minibuffer'."
         (when (member buf eldoc-active-minibuffers-list)
           (with-current-buffer buf
             (let* ((sym (save-excursion
-                          (unless (looking-back ")\\|\"")
+                          (unless (looking-back ")\\|\"" (1- (point)))
                             (forward-char -1))
                           (eldoc-current-symbol)))
                    (info-fn (eldoc-fnsym-in-current-sexp))



reply via email to

[Prev in Thread] Current Thread [Next in Thread]